A temporary swimming pool and leisure complex is planned in Seven Kings.
The proposal, put forward by Redbridge Council leader Cllr Keith Prince’s administration, would see a 25m swimming pool, a new gym and a library service built on the Seven Kings station car park in High Road.
But it has been criticised by the borough’s Labour group.
In this week’s Recorder, Cllr Prince issued a plea to Labour group leader Cllr Jas Athwal to provide details of a better plan at a similar cost.
And Cllr Athwal judged the temporary scheme “an incredibly bad business proposition”.
